I would like to use OC 3.0.3.6 (PHP 7.3, MySQL 8 )
Question can InnoDB can be use without any problem?
What I have done :
I already modified the SQL file to use charset and InnoDB
And set charset in PHP ini file.
I have cleanup the SQL file by removing demo data and cleanup auto-increment
Is there anything else I should do in order to use InnoDB
I know to speed up the DB I can add index and I can disable product count.

Opencart Turbo - InnoDB DB Engine Changer
I use this fine tool for a long time already, it does it's Job
well, and it functions most likely independent of the OC Version used.
Just add it into the Shop/ ROOT Directory, disable the .htaccess
temporarely, by renaming it to _.htaccess , to avoid, that it
eventually blocks Access, and execute the File, by calling it with your Browser,
like http(s):// yourshopsite . com / shop / turbo.php
It also indexes the Database, just to have it mentioned too ...
Use the one enclosed below, it's the latest Version I know of, and it has some
function turbo_flush_buffers() routine built-in, not yet existing in
the first release. But note, I've not tested it yet in PHP v.7.4x Environments,
but you will find aut, it either works, or then not ...
